Bay Area clinches semifinal spot

By Ivan Stewart Saldajeno

December 9, 2022, 7:16 pm

MANILA – Bay Area will move on to the PBA Commissioner's Cup semifinals after handing Rain Or Shine a blowout defeat, 126-96, in their quarterfinal game on Friday at the PhilSports Arena in Pasig City.

The top-seeded Dragons quickly opened a lead as high as 22 points, 46-24, midway through the second quarter.

The Elasto Painters showed signs of life after cutting the lead down to nine, 49-40, but the Dragons finished the second strong to blow the game wide open for good.

Hayden Blankley led Bay Area with 47 points, 10 rebounds, one assist, one block, and one steal. The team will await the winner of the quarterfinal series between Converge and San Miguel in the semis.

Andrew Nicholson added 32 points, eight rebounds, and two assists in his first game back, while Glen Yang chipped in 13 points, six rebounds, 10 assists and one steal.

The Beermen can set their semis date with the Dragons with a Game 2 win on Saturday night also at the PhilSports Arena.

Rey Nambatac put up 19 points, four rebounds and one steal while Andrei Caracut added 12 points, one rebound, 11 assists and one steal for ROS. (PNA)
